Ok I know this topic has been beat to death but I just need to ask.
I just got a Mass Air Sensor from my work and It came up different Part numbers so I got then 74-9502 sensor from A1Cardone. From a 90 Mustang GT.
Does it matter what MAF sensor I got? Does it make a Difference?
Also Im going to the junk yard tomarrow to pick up a computer, now whats the difference from the A9P and A9L ? Does it matter if its Stick or Auto?

I don't think it matters as long as the MAF is caled for the right size injector.
As for the computer, I believe you can use a A9P (auto) in a stick car, but you can't use a A9L(stick) in an auto.
